What drives species’ distributions along elevational gradients? Macroecological and ‐evolutionary insights from Brassicaceae of the central Alps

Geographic distribution limits of organisms are often affected by climate, but little is known of how the impacts of climate evolve within sets of related taxa. Here we identified the climate variables most closely associated with low‐elevation limits, optimal elevations, and high‐elevation limits of plant species’ distributions and compared evolutionary lability of niche values predicting the three aspects of distribution best.

是什么驱动物种沿着海拔梯度分布?来自阿尔卑斯山中部十字花科的宏观生态学和进化见解

生物的地理分布范围通常受气候影响,但人们对气候的影响如何在一组相关的分类单元内演化知之甚少。在这里,我们确定了与植物物种分布的低海拔限度,最佳海拔和高海拔限度最密切相关的气候变量,并比较了利基值的进化不稳定性预测了分布的三个方面。
